Quarterly Planning Note — FX Hedging

Hi all — quick update for branch managers ahead of planning season. Head office has decided to hedge roughly 65% of our velden-currency receivables for the next two quarters, after the swings we all felt last spring. Practically, this means steadier branch-level margins and fewer surprise adjustments at month end. Pricing guidance stays unchanged for now. Questions go to regional finance, not treasury directly. The thinking behind the move is summarized just below.

management briefing: Project Ulavan slips by two quarters because of the staffing delay.

Action item: The Relayn deploy-status bot silently dropped updates when the pipeline API paginated results, so responders believed a rollback had completed when it had not. We will add pagination handling, a staleness banner, and an integration test. Until merged, verify deploy state directly in the pipeline console, documented at the page below.

runbook for kahop-kajop: https://rundeck.ordinio.test/display/secrets/pipeline/issue/pages/repo/browse/e5732776e07d1285107e5aeb

# Westmere Region Expansion (Managers Only)

This page summarises the planned expansion of Quillon Foods into the Westmere region. Finance should note capital outlay is phased over three quarters, with the first distribution hub leased rather than purchased. Headcount additions are limited to fourteen roles initially. Break-even is modelled at month nineteen under conservative volume assumptions. Local regulatory filings are underway. The following note is restricted and must not be shared outside this group.

board note of baweg-bawig: Project Tamath slips by six weeks because of the audit delay.